RFK Jr. Links Gender Dysphoria to Chemicals
In an interview with YouTube podcaster Jordan Peterson, Robert F. Kennedy Jr., 2024 presidential candidate, claimed “a lot of sexual dysphoria” comes from exposure to chemicals in water.
“I think a lot of the problems we see in kids, particularly boys ... it’s probably underappreciated how much of that is coming from chemical exposures, including a lot of the sexual dysphoria that we’re seeing. I mean, they’re swimming through a soup of toxic chemicals today, and many of those are endocrine disruptors. There’s atrazine (a herbicide) throughout our water supply,” he said.
“Atrazine, by the way, if you, in a lab, put atrazine in a tank full of frogs, it will chemically castrate and forcefully feminize every frog in there,” he continued. “And 10 percent of the frogs, the male frogs, will turn into fully viable females able to produce viable eggs. If it’s doing that to frogs, it could ... there’s a lot of other evidence that it’s doing it to human beings as well.”
According to CDC (Centers for Disease Control and Prevention), studies, “When the general population is exposed to atrazine, exposure levels are expected to be very low. Maximum seasonal and average atrazine concentrations of 61.6 and 18.9 ppb, respectively, were detected during a 1993-1998 monitoring program of community water systems in the United States. There was a possible association between atrazine use/exposure of male farmers and increased pre-term delivery, but not decreased fecundity,” the agency said. “Epidemiological studies, examining developmental end points, have found an association between Iowa communities exposed to atrazine in the drinking water and an increased risk of small for gestational age babies and other birth defects.”
While the CDC and various “experts” either minimize or openly scoff at Kennedy’s claims, in 2004, researchers in Colorado discovered male fish were developing female sex organs and scientists concluded the cause could be the amount of estrogen found in water throughout the U.S. At the time, John Woodling, a researcher with more than 30 years in the aquatic biology field, remarked, “I’ve done a lot of studies throughout my career which extends back to 1973. This is the very first time that what I’ve found scared me.”
Government researchers found natural estrogens and estrogen mimickers in 80 percent of streams tested in 30 states, and this was 19 years ago. Estrogen mimickers, believed to be caused by nonylphenols, are found in everything from paints and rubber to cosmetics and plastics, and many scientists believe they could possibly cause kidney, eye, liver and reproductive problems.
